    Hi everybody i am prashmith,a 14 year old kid who always dreamed of someday making his own liquid cooled pc from ground up.It took me a one year of planning, but now i am ready to go big with my first scratch build, BLACK PANTHER!

    Now i had absolutely zero experience before this and i am from india,now liquid cooling market is Zero here so i had to import all the parts from uk or china.Still despite all the setbacks i am making Black panther a reality!

    due to lack of good camera i will avoid uploading the pictures of the case for now,consider it a surprise!

    I started by learning sketch up and within a week drew some basic lousy design and improved from there. Once i had my "simplicity is the most complexity" inspired design ready i decided to go with making a case.

    the following stuff is going inside black panther

    undecided motherboard with 6gen processor
    corsair vengeance LPX ddr4 16gb
    nvidia pascal 1070 gpu
    intel 520 ssd x2
    2x seagate 1tb hdd
    400mm LONG reservoir
    ek supremacy evo copper plexi
    ek 1070 waterblock
    ek ram monarch
    ek coolstream se slim triple
    another 360 radiator

    I learned how to use tools,YES Learned em myself with youtube. Saw,Dremel,soldering,drill everything(i do have parents OK,and had hard time explaining them all this)

    Here is the case,i don't have good pics of it in the works.

    Now i started with ply and wood
    [​IMG]
    Nailed aluminium over it
    [​IMG]
    Painted it panther black and Eureka! This is how the case looks like today.
